Get "PuTTY Link" and "Pageant" (an SSH key agent) from the PuTTY download page Show archive.org snapshot .
-
Run
pageant.exe, find its icon inside your system tray and add your SSH key. -
Open up a
cmdand put the full path to PuTTY'splink.exeinto theGIT_SSHenvironment variable, e.g.:set GIT_SSH=D:\PuTTY\plink.exe
You can then use Git like you would on any sane operating system. Just go ahead and git clone, git pull, etc.
Also, you may want to add the environment variable under the Windows system properties so it survives a reboot.
